iOS 5应用开发入门:经典与入门须知
iOS 5是苹果公司于2011年推出的一款智能手机操作系统,为用户带来了全新的移动体验。同时,iOS 5也为开发者提供了更丰富的开发环境,支持更多的应用程序和功能。因此,对于想要开发iOS应用程序的人来说,iOS 5是一个很好的入门和学习平台。
在介绍iOS 5应用开发入门之前,我们需要先了解一下iOS 5的一些特点和优势。iOS 5拥有更快的运行速度,可以更流畅地运行应用程序。还支持多点触控,用户可以通过手指滑动来操作屏幕上的内容。另外,iOS 5还支持地铁模式,可以在地铁等场景下提供更加方便的用户体验。
iOS 5应用开发需要掌握一些基本知识。例如,我们需要了解iOS 5的界面布局和控件,掌握了一些基本的UI组件的使用方法。还需要了解iOS 5的框架和API,例如UIKit、Core Data和Core Animation等。
在了解了iOS 5的基础知识之后,我们可以开始学习iOS 5应用开发的具体内容了。首先,我们可以通过Xcode来创建一个新的iOS应用程序。在Xcode中,我们可以通过拖拽和布局控件来创建UI,也可以通过编写代码来设置UI的属性。
接下来,我们需要了解iOS 5中的几种重要框架和API。iOS 5中的UIKit框架提供了许多常用的UI控件和组件,例如按钮、文本框、图像和列表等。通过使用UIKit框架,我们可以更加方便地创建iOS应用程序。
另外,Core Data框架也是iOS 5中一个非常重要的框架。它提供了数据存储和管理功能,可以用来保存用户数据和应用程序的状态。通过使用Core Data框架,我们可以更加方便地管理和维护应用程序的数据。
最后,Core Animation框架也是iOS 5中一个非常实用的框架。它提供了动态用户界面元素的能力,例如滑动、旋转和缩放等。通过使用Core Animation框架,我们可以更加方便地创建动态的UI元素。
除了了解iOS 5的基础知识、框架和API之外,我们还需要学习一些开发技巧和最佳实践。例如,我们需要了解如何优化应用程序的性能,如何处理用户反馈和错误,以及如何保护应用程序的安全性等。
iOS 5是一个非常有价值的开发平台,尤其适合初学者和那些想要小清新应用程序开发入门的人。掌握iOS 5应用开发的基本知识,学习iOS 5框架和API,了解iOS 5开发技巧和最佳实践,都可以更加顺利地开发出更加优美、更加有趣的应用程序。